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23256 9140056 28073610784 88507
17 617587
17 617587
70 7221 5302
All about undefined
Interested in learning more?
17 617587
70 7221 5302
See more
512 05772373
2211944084 30990 6196927 3819 972
See more
8969343440 6377824
73330992247 32 82264000495 92428
See more